新聞中心
數(shù)字簽名是一種加密技術(shù),用于驗(yàn)證信息來源和完整性,確保信息在傳輸過程中不被篡改,類似于現(xiàn)實(shí)中的手寫簽名。
數(shù)字簽名是一種用于驗(yàn)證電子文檔完整性和來源身份的加密技術(shù),它類似于手寫簽名,但采用了數(shù)學(xué)算法來保證電子信息的安全和可信度,數(shù)字簽名確保了消息在傳輸過程中未被篡改,并驗(yàn)證發(fā)送者的身份。

數(shù)字簽名的工作原理:
1. 創(chuàng)建數(shù)字簽名
- 生成密鑰對(duì):用戶需要生成一對(duì)密鑰,包括一個(gè)私鑰和一個(gè)公鑰,私鑰是保密的,而公鑰可以公開分享。
- 哈希運(yùn)算:使用哈希函數(shù)處理要簽名的數(shù)據(jù),生成一個(gè)固定長度的摘要(哈希值)。
- 私鑰加密:接著,使用私鑰對(duì)哈希值進(jìn)行加密,生成數(shù)字簽名。
2. 驗(yàn)證數(shù)字簽名
- 公鑰解密:接收方使用發(fā)送方提供的公鑰對(duì)數(shù)字簽名進(jìn)行解密,得到原始的哈希值。
- 對(duì)比哈希值:接收方也獨(dú)立地對(duì)收到的數(shù)據(jù)進(jìn)行哈希運(yùn)算,生成新的哈希值。
- 驗(yàn)證一致性:比較這兩個(gè)哈希值,如果它們一致,說明數(shù)據(jù)在傳輸過程中沒有被篡改,并且確實(shí)是由聲稱的發(fā)送方簽名的。
數(shù)字簽名的特點(diǎn):
| 特點(diǎn) | 描述 |
| 不可否認(rèn)性 | 一旦簽名,發(fā)送者不能否認(rèn)他們簽署過該文件。 |
| 完整性 | 確保文件在傳輸過程中沒有被修改。 |
| 認(rèn)證性 | 可以驗(yàn)證消息確實(shí)來自聲稱的發(fā)送者。 |
| 依賴于PKI基礎(chǔ)設(shè)施 | 通常依賴于公鑰基礎(chǔ)設(shè)施(PKI)來分發(fā)和管理密鑰。 |
實(shí)際應(yīng)用:
數(shù)字簽名廣泛應(yīng)用于電子郵件、軟件發(fā)布、合同簽署等領(lǐng)域,以確保信息的安全性和可靠性。
相關(guān)問題與解答
問題1: 數(shù)字簽名能否保護(hù)信息不被泄露?
答案: 數(shù)字簽名主要用于驗(yàn)證信息的完整性和來源,而不是用來保護(hù)信息不被泄露,如果要保護(hù)信息內(nèi)容的隱私,通常還需要使用加密技術(shù)。
問題2: 如果私鑰丟失怎么辦?
答案: 如果私鑰丟失,將無法生成有效的數(shù)字簽名,且已簽署的文件的有效性可能受到質(zhì)疑,保護(hù)好私鑰至關(guān)重要,一些系統(tǒng)可能會(huì)有備份或復(fù)原機(jī)制,但這取決于具體的安全策略和實(shí)施情況,如果確信私鑰已經(jīng)泄露,應(yīng)立即廢棄該密鑰對(duì),并生成新的密鑰對(duì)以繼續(xù)進(jìn)行安全通信。
網(wǎng)頁標(biāo)題:數(shù)字簽名是什么意思?
轉(zhuǎn)載來于:http://www.5511xx.com/article/cogceeg.html


咨詢
建站咨詢
